The BeiDou navigation upgrade programme will affect all 50 satellites in China’s constellation, the China Satellite Navigation Office (CSNO) stated on March 13, 2026. The work will be conducted entirely in-orbit, making it one of the largest remote software update operations in satellite history.

The CSNO said the upgrade focuses on optimising and adjusting the operational status of individual satellites. Furthermore, the office stated efforts would be made to strengthen joint debugging and testing of the satellites while they remain in orbit.

Scope of the BeiDou Navigation Upgrade

The telecommunications and navigation infrastructure spans three orbital classes. BeiDou comprises geostationary, inclined geosynchronous, and medium Earth orbit satellites. In addition, the system includes a comprehensive set of land-based ground equipment.

A third element of the system covers user equipment, including chips, modules, and antennas. The CSNO noted these components are compatible with other satellite navigation systems currently in operation.

Industrial and Economic Applications

BeiDou serves a broad range of industrial sectors across China. According to CSNO data, active applications include transport, agriculture, forestry, and aquaculture. The system also supports disaster recovery operations and critical national infrastructure.

The CSNO stated the constellation has generated “significant economic and social benefits” since entering full operational service. The upgrade programme aims to deliver measurable improvements to user experience across all these sectors.

2035 Roadmap for Spatiotemporal Intelligence

The in-orbit upgrades form part of a longer-term development roadmap. The CSNO stated the BeiDou navigation upgrade keeps the constellation on track to deliver a more integrated and intelligent spatiotemporal system by 2035.

Consequently, the 2035 target positions BeiDou as a comprehensive positioning, navigation, and timing platform. The system is expected to expand its role in economy-critical sectors as the upgrade programme progresses through the coming years.
